Understanding Cutting Tool Design Principles
Effective fabricating necessitates a thorough knowledge of cutting implement design basics. The shape – encompassing factors like rake, relief angle, and blade degree – plays a critical function in determining scrap makeup, finish texture, and total tool function. Precise consideration of these aspects during the creation stage is crucial for achieving maximum stock subtraction rates and extending implement longevity.

Extending the Life of Cutting Tools: Maintenance Tips
To extend the service life of your blades , regular maintenance is critically important . Frequently inspect your tools for wear and discard any that show noticeable signs of degradation . Appropriate clearing of the cutting edge after each operation helps prevent accumulation of swarf, which can rapidly impair the tool’s sharpness. Consider utilizing appropriate lubricants to minimize friction and heat during the shaping task.
